What is a disability van called?
A handicap conversion van (alternatively called a mobility van or wheelchair van) is the name given to a specially engineered adaptation of a vehicle to make it accessible for wheelchair users.
Why are handicap vans lifted?
Suspension in the rear of the vehicle is typically raised via taller springs to allow extra weight and increased ground clearance partially compensating the lowered floor. Higher quality vehicles typically raise all four corners of the vehicle to preserve OEM driving characteristics.

Which is the best way to convert a handicap Van?
A critical aspect of your handicap van conversion is the method of securing your wheelchair or electric scooter. Two of the most popular methods are the Q Straint adjustable wheelchair straps and the EZLock wheelchair docking system. Q Straint is the less expensive option, and features a 4-point anchor system for your wheelchair tie-downs.
